Web7 apr. 2024 · Horse riding is a sport in many ways, it requires incredible core strength, stamina and strong legs. It obviously depends what discipline you are riding in such as show jumping, trail riding, dressage or a hack; all areas will require different outputs of energy and can use different muscles. The rider must … WebHorse riding became a sport when it was recognized by the International Olympic Committee (IOC). The first modern Olympics, held in Athens in 1896, included a riding competition; however, it was not until the 1912 games in Stockholm that this activity gained recognition as a separate sport. WebRiding a horse requires you to: Balance Steer your horse Give your horse cues to turn, move faster, move slower, etc. Perform any additional requirements that the rider’s … WebEquestrian, which can also be called horseback riding, can be referred to as the skill of riding with horses. Equestrian can be for recreational purposes and competitive sport. In the early 20th century, equestrian events were introduced in the Olympics. Some of these events are still seen today. These events are: dressage, show jumping, and ...
